基于可编程逻辑器件的四位奇偶校验器设计.docx

上传人:b****9 文档编号:23418736 上传时间:2023-05-16 格式:DOCX 页数:7 大小:130.23KB
下载 相关 举报
基于可编程逻辑器件的四位奇偶校验器设计.docx_第1页
第1页 / 共7页
基于可编程逻辑器件的四位奇偶校验器设计.docx_第2页
第2页 / 共7页
基于可编程逻辑器件的四位奇偶校验器设计.docx_第3页
第3页 / 共7页
基于可编程逻辑器件的四位奇偶校验器设计.docx_第4页
第4页 / 共7页
基于可编程逻辑器件的四位奇偶校验器设计.docx_第5页
第5页 / 共7页
点击查看更多>>
下载资源
资源描述

基于可编程逻辑器件的四位奇偶校验器设计.docx

《基于可编程逻辑器件的四位奇偶校验器设计.docx》由会员分享,可在线阅读,更多相关《基于可编程逻辑器件的四位奇偶校验器设计.docx(7页珍藏版)》请在冰豆网上搜索。

基于可编程逻辑器件的四位奇偶校验器设计.docx

基于可编程逻辑器件的四位奇偶校验器设计

新疆大学课程设计

 

题目:

基于可编程逻辑器件的四位奇偶校验器设计

指导老师:

学生姓名:

所属院系:

电气工程学院

专业:

班级:

学号:

 

本科生课程设计任务书

班级:

姓名:

设计题目:

基于可编程逻辑器件的四位奇偶校验器设计

要求完成的内容:

1.设计出一个奇偶校验逻辑电路,当四位数中有奇数个1时输出结果为1;否则为0。

2.写出该电路的真值表。

3.采用逻辑门电路或可编程逻辑阵列PLA实现。

4.画出详细的电路图。

5.写出详细的原理说明。

 

指导教师:

教研室主任:

 

 

一、概述

奇偶校验是一种荣誉编码校验,在存储器中是按存储单元为单位进行的,是依靠硬件实现的,因而适时性强,但这种校验方法只能发现奇数个错,如果数据发生偶数位个错,由于不影响码子的奇偶性质,因而不能发现。

奇偶校验是一种校验代码传输正确性的方法。

根据被传输的一组二进制代码的数位中“1”的个数是奇数或偶数来进行校验。

采用奇数的称为奇校验,反之,称为偶校验。

采用何种校验是事先规定好的。

通常专门设置一个奇偶校验位,用它使这组代码中“1”的个数为奇数或偶数。

若用奇校验,则当接收端收到这组代码时,校验“1”的个数是否为奇数,从而确定传输代码的正确性。

二、写出详细的原理说明

奇偶校验法是对数据传输正确性的一种校验方法。

我们所涉及的奇偶校验逻辑电路是用来表示传输的数据中"1"的个数是奇数还是偶数,为奇数时,校验位置为"1",否则置为"0"。

例如,需要传输"1101",数据中含3个"1",所以其奇校验位为"1",需要传输"1111",数据中含4个"1",所以其偶校验位为"0"。

上面设计的奇偶校验逻辑电路就是属于单向奇偶校验逻辑电路,当我们输入一个四位数1000时A,B端所流的直流通过U1A异或门后输出为高电平,而C,D端所流的直流通过U2A异或门后输出为低电平,它们个别通过U6A和U7A非门后输出的是低电平,高电平。

最后通过与非门时输出为高电平,灯亮。

当我们输入1100时A,B端所流的直流通过U1A异或门后输出为低电平,而C,D端所流的直流通过U2A异或门后输出为低电平,流过U6A和U7A非门后输出的是高电平,高电平。

通过与非门时输出为低电平,灯灭。

其他14个四位数的原理都跟这上面的原理类似。

 

 

三、写出该电路的真值表:

输入

输出

ABCD

Y

0000

0

0001

1

0010

1

0011

0

0100

1

0101

0

0110

0

0111

1

1000

1

1001

0

1010

0

1011

1

1100

0

1101

1

1110

1

1111

0

备注:

(A,B,C,D分别为校验器的四个输入端,Y时校验器的输出端)

画出该电路的卡诺图:

写出该电路的表达式:

四、采用逻辑门电路或可编程逻辑阵列PLA实现

 

五、画出详细的电路图

当四位数中有奇数个1时的电路图(输出结果为1,灯亮):

当四位数中有偶数个1时的电路图(输出结果为0,灯灭):

 

六、总结与体会

为了系统的可靠性,对于位数较少,电路较简单的应用,可以采用奇偶校验的方法。

奇校验是通过增加一位校验位的逻辑取值,在源端将原数据代码中为1的位数形成奇数,然后在宿端使用该代码时,连同校验位一起检查为1的位数是否是奇数,做出进一步操作的决定。

奇偶校验只能检查一位错误,且没有纠错的能力。

偶校验道理与奇校验相同,只是将校验位连同原数据代码中为1的位数形成偶数。

奇偶校验器多设计成九位二进制数,以适应一个字节,一个ASCII代码的应用要求。

在这次设计的过程中我们也遇到了很多困难,难免会遇到过各种各样的问题,同时在设计的过程中发现了自己的不足之处,对以前所学过的知识理解得不够深刻,掌握得不够牢固,比如说在设计奇偶校验逻辑电路的时候,该用哪个芯片,怎么使用,如何来设计电路图都把我们难道了,最后还是认真的看书和讨论才明白了解决这些问题的思路。

光设计电路图然后输出结果上花了整整的两天时间。

通过这次课程设计还锻炼了我们的团队合作精神,只有大家在分工明确的基础上齐心协力,才能是团队获得成就。

通过这次课程设计使我懂得了理论与实际相结合是很重要的,只有理论知识是远远不够的,只有把所学的理论知识与实践相结合起来,从理论中得出结论,才能真正为社会服务,从而提高自己的实际动手能力和独立思考的能力。

 

附:

主要参考书目:

《电子基础技术》

《网络资料》

《电子基础技术实验指导书》

 

指导教师评语:

 

 

要求:

1、封面页、任务书页和指导教师评语页采用给定的模版。

封面页、任务书页分别为第一、第二页,指导教师评语页为最后一页。

2、论文内容采用小四号字打印。

asanjian0531@

..

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 幼儿教育 > 育儿知识

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1